About Uptimelabs Expand

Uptime Labs delivers realistic incident response simulation and training, targeting leaders responsible for high-severity cyber and availability incidents. It helps teams practice critical coordination and decision-making skills in a controlled environment.

The platform's core offering includes multi-player simulations, a broad library of scenarios, and expert coaching to identify and close skill gaps. This specialized approach addresses a crucial need for hands-on, practical experience in a field where real-world mistakes carry significant consequences.
